AP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

就用这些h5制作app

随着移动设备的普及,成千上万的应用程序被发布到各个移动应用商店中。但在过去的几年中,HTML5技术的迅速发展,使得开发者们开始将其应用到移动应用程序的开发中。这种新的开发方式将HTML、CSS和JavaScript用于开发日常应用程序,而不仅仅是用于开发网站和Web应用程序。

使用HTML5开发应用程序有许多优点,其中最大的优点是跨平台性。这意味着可以使用相同的代码在不同的设备和操作系统上构建应用程序。因此,可以在简化的开发流程中更加高效地编写代码。以下是详细介绍如何使用HTML5开发应用程序。

一、利用Webview容器

开发者可以使用自带的Webview容器,以Webview为载体,通过打包加载HTML5页面,实现HTML5应用程序的开发。

Webview本质上是一个小型的Web浏览器,能够在应用内部加载HTML、CSS、JavaScript等网页技术,并且支持交互操作。因此,基于Webview的应用程序具有良好的跨平台性,开发效率也很高。

二、使用Web App Framework

Web App Framework是一个整合了各种HTML、CSS和JavaScript技术的集成开发环境。它不仅提供了很多组件和插件,也提供了一些特殊的函数和API,使得开发者们能够创建不同类型的应用程序。

目前较为流行的有Sencha Touch、Ionic、Framework7等Web App Framework。使用Web App Framework能够加速开发进程,使得开发者们不需要再从头开始构建应用程序。

三、使用Hybrid App

Hybrid App是连接Web技术和原生应用的桥梁。Hybrid App是在本地环境下,利用HTML5技术开发的应用程序。

Hybrid App是通过一个HTML5文件来布局应用程序的界面,在这个页面内部呈现的内容被包裹在一个Webview容器内展示,这种展示方式可以保证应用程序的完整性以及能够运行在不同的平台上。

四、结合React Native

React Native是一个基于React的移动应用框架,开发者可以使用它来创建本地iOS和Android应用程序。React Native框架建立在React组件编程模型的基础上,能够忠实地转换成原生应用程序的组件。

由于React Native具有Web开发环境的特性,因此不需要太多的原生代码就能够开发出原生应用程序。因此,使用React Native开发应用程序的效率远远高于使用原生开发。

总之,利用HTML5技术可以大大地简化开发流程,工作效率也会相应提高。四种使用HTML5开发应用程序的方式都各有优劣,开发者可以根据具体的需求来进行选择。不过需要注意的是,无论使用哪种方式开发,都需要遵循相关的开发规范和标准,确保应用程序的安全性和稳定性。


相关知识:
怎么把网页h5游戏做成app
将网页H5游戏做成App的过程主要包括以下几个步骤:1.克隆游戏代码首先,需要将H5游戏的代码克隆到本地。这可以通过直接下载游戏的代码文件或使用Git等版本控制工具来完成。如果使用Git进行克隆操作,则可以在命令行中输入以下命令:```git clone
2023-05-26
免费h5制作app哪个好用
随着智能手机的普及,移动应用程序的需求也逐渐增加。对于小型企业和创业公司来说,想要自主研发一款APP可能会比较困难,其原因主要包括缺乏人力技术、费用高昂等。然而,现在市场上出现了一些免费的H5制作工具,可以帮助小企业快速制作自己的APP。那么,免费H5制作
2023-05-26
uni app h5 打包失败
H5打包是Uni App中非常重要的一环,因为H5环境是Uni App在各个平台上的通用运行环境,也是开发者们向大众发布应用的最直接的方式。但是,有时候在H5打包过程中会遇到各种各样的问题。本文将介绍H5打包失败的原因以及处理方法。一、背景知识在以前,移动
2023-05-25
h5做app哪个好用
在现代手机应用市场上,随着HTML5技术的成熟,将网页应用直接转化为原生应用已经成为可能。而这种方法就是利用HTML5技术来开发跨平台的手机应用程序。下面我们就来说一说究竟HTML5的应用运用哪家强。1. PhoneGapPhoneGap是由Adobe公司
2023-05-25
h5做的app如何手势返回
在移动应用开发中,手势返回是一种非常常见的功能,用户可以通过手势快速返回上一个页面,提高了用户操作的便捷性和体验度。在H5开发中也可以实现手势返回的功能,并且方法较为简单。本文将介绍手势返回的原理及详细实现方法。一、手势返回原理移动设备上的手势交互一般是由
2023-05-25
h5做app框架
H5做APP框架是一种轻量级的移动应用开发方式,可以通过H5技术快速地创建一个移动应用,跨平台兼容性强,成本也相对较低。本文将介绍H5做APP框架的原理和详细步骤。1. 原理H5做APP框架是基于WebView来实现的,WebView是一个基于WebKit
2023-05-25
h5开发app好吗
HTML5可以用于开发跨平台应用程序,即网页应用程序,也可以用于开发原生应用程序。相关技术包括CSS3和JavaScript。 H5开发App的优点:1.跨平台:可以使用相同的代码库在各种设备和操作系统上运行应用,节省开发周期和成本。 2. 高可访问性:不
2023-05-25
h5开发app上线流程图
H5开发APP上线流程图可以分为如下5个步骤:1. 开发阶段在开发阶段,我们需要选择合适的H5开发框架,例如React、Vue等。根据App的需求规划并确定App的基本架构,包括页面数量以及页面展示效果。开发人员按照架构设计开始开发,包括前端展示以及后端接
2023-05-25
h5封装安卓app
H5封装安卓App是使用HTML5技术,将Web App包装成为可以在安卓系统上运行的App。H5封装App具有成本低、开发速度快、跨平台支持好等特点,目前被广泛应用于各种应用开发。下面将详细介绍H5封装安卓App的原理和实现方法。一、原理1.1 WebV
2023-05-25
app网站封装内嵌h5
随着移动互联网的不断发展,越来越多的企业开始关注和使用移动应用程序(App),而网站封装内嵌H5已经成为很多企业选择开发新应用的方式。网站封装内嵌H5是一种令人兴奋的技术,使企业能够快速创建优秀的跨平台应用程序,通过这种方法,企业可以极大地简化应用程序的开
2023-05-25
app打包生成的h5页面
App打包生成的H5页面是一种将Web页面打包进移动应用程序中的技术。这种技术将Web应用程序的代码、资源和界面放入一个独立于浏览器的容器中,以实现更好的用户体验和更快的页面加载速度。App打包生成的H5页面的原理是将Web应用程序经过特殊处理后,将其打包
2023-05-25
appium做纯h5测试
Appium是一种用于自动化移动应用程序和移动网页的开源工具。它支持各种语言(Java、Python、Ruby、JavaScript)和各种测试框架(JUnit、TestNG等)。而在移动应用中,纯H5应用也是比较常见的。那么,如何在Appium中测试纯H
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3